World Premiere of ‘The God Who Speaks’ Film Set for Southern Evangelical Seminary Apologetics Conference

Monday, September 18, 2017 @ 10:48 AM

CHARLOTTE, N.C.—How do we know the Bible is the Word of God and not merely the words of men?

We know this truth because of the simple fact that the God of the universe is a God who speaks. It’s this divine self-expression that sustains creation and reveals the wisdom of God to humanity through the pages of the Bible.

This truth will be further revealed next month at Southern Evangelical Seminary’s (SES, www.ses.edu) 24th annual National Conference on Christian Apologetics through the world premiere of the American Family Association (AFA) film “The God Who Speaks.” Conference attendees will be among the first to view the feature.

One of the largest events of its kind, the conference will focus on the timely theme of “Pursuing a Faith That Thinks,” and the two-day event will delve into headline-making topics on Oct. 13-14 at Calvary Church in Charlotte, N.C.

“We are honored that the American Family Association chose to debut its new film, ‘The God Who Speaks,’ at the 24th annual National Conference on Christian Apologetics,” said SES President and Evangelical leader Dr. Richard Land. “For 25 years, SES has helped believers defend their faith, teaching Christians of all ages to know what they believe and why they believe it. So it’s significant that SES conference attendees will be the first in the world to watch and consider this film. AFA’s movie, featuring some of the most able defenders of truth of our time, is an integral part of the education process to equip and empower Christians to spread the Good News of Christ.”

American Family Studios, a division of AFA, describes “The God Who Speaks” as a powerful feature-length documentary that explores the evidence of the Bible’s inspiration and authority through some of the most highly respected voices within evangelicalism. The film answers some common objections and observes the effects of denying biblical authority, as well as intends to reveal the trustworthiness of the Bible’s claims. A tool to use for decades to come, “The God Who Speaks” will help many of today’s biblically illiterate Christians defend their faith in a culture that is often hostile to Christianity.

“The God Who Speaks” is directed by M.D. Perkins, a filmmaker and writer with American Family Studios, and produced by Jeff Chamblee, director of American Family Studios. Dr. Richard Howe, SES emeritus professor of philosophy and apologetics who will be a featured speaker at the SES conference, served as a theological advisor to the production and is a writer, speaker and debater in churches, conferences, and university campuses. Contributors featured in the documentary include: Alistair Begg of Parkside Church; Norman Geisler, co-founder of Southern Evangelical Seminary; Josh McDowell of Josh McDowell Ministries; Alex McFarland of North Greenville University and Alex McFarland Ministries; R. Albert Mohler of Southern Baptist Theological Seminary; R.C. Sproul of Ligonier Ministries; and Frank Turek of Cross Examined Ministries, who will also be a featured speaker at the SES conference.

On the first evening of the SES conference (Oct. 13), “The God Who Speaks” film will debut in two parts, from 2:45-3:45 p.m. and from 4-5 p.m. Conference participants will have a chance to reflect on the film over dinner, then attend a special AFA-sponsored debate from 7-9 p.m. between Howe and Dan Barker titled, “Is There a God Who Speaks?” SES will honor its past presidents just before the debate from 6:30-7 p.m.

The two-day SES conference will also welcome the nation’s top apologists, who will give the thousands in attendance new presentations on studies, research, history and insight into apologetics and other intellectual, scientific and religious fields. In addition to Land, Geisler, Howe and Turek, confirmed speakers include Michael Brown, Gary Habermas, Ken Ham, Greg Koukl, J.P. Moreland, Jay Richards, Hugh Ross and J. Warner Wallace, along with many others.
